The current interconnectivity only allows the viewing of the current screen you are using on the GP1870F. In other words if you are looking at the sounder, your iPad shows the sounder. There is no data transfer or control available. I will admit that the sounder repeater is nice when in the cockpit, but there is no control.

At this point in time we have no information on when or if an Android connection will be available.
